Medicines For Lebanon Refugees

Medicines distributed at the refugee camps in Beirut and trauma relief camps were conducted in September 2006.

IAHV Middle East, in association with Dubai Humanitarian City, launched a medicine collection drive. The volunteers in Lebanon gave a list of essential medicines that were required and this was circulated to IAHV volunteers all around UAE.

The American hospital donated essential life support medical equipment also along with medicines. The total value of the shipment was around $200,000. The logistics of reaching the shipment were very difficult, as Israel had blockaded surface and air traffic.

The shipment was sent by road to Damascus, then to Jordan. From there it was eventually flow in by Queen Rania’s private plane to reach Beirut.
